Example Of Animal Mimicry. mimicry is an adaptation in which one animal evolves to look like another animal. mimicry, in biology, phenomenon characterized by the superficial resemblance of two or more organisms that are not closely related. animals mimic other animals, plants, and other things, in a wide variety of ways, from visual mimicry to auditory or olfactory imitation. The simple reason why this occurs naturally in animals is that it provides the advantage of survival. one can observe mimicry in animals if they display physical or behavioral traits of another species, or even aspects of the surroundings in which the animal is usually found.
